Liverpool and Arsenal 'interested in signing Bayern Munich star Joshua Kimmich'

It would be a statement signing.

Chris Byfield

Chris Byfield

Liverpool and Arsenal have both been linked with a surprise approach for Bayern Munich’s Joshua Kimmich, it has been claimed.

A costly late-season loss of form has seen Arsenal fall short in their attempt to claim their first Premier League title in 19 years.

Yet, fresh from having secured Bukayo Saka to a new contract, the Gunners will be busy in the summer transfer market in a bid to close the gap with Manchester City.

Advert

Meanwhile, Liverpool have endured a topsy-turvy trophy-less campaign that will likely see them finish in a Europa League spot.

In turn, Jurgen Klopp has been tipped to bring in several reinforcements in the summer, with the midfield in particular, a position set to be addressed.

The club have been linked to Ryan Gravenberch, Alexis Mac Allister, Moises Caicedo, Conor Gallagher and Mason Mount in the past few months alone.

And Liverpool fans can now add Kimmich to the score of names reportedly on Klopp’s wishlist.

Arsenal and Liverpool want Kimmich?

According to Spanish publication Marca, Barcelona are eyeing up Bayern Munich’s Kimmich, but face competition from Arsenal and Liverpool.

Advert

The German international is one of the finest midfielders in Europe, while he can also operate as a right-back.

Indeed, he has played 32 times in the Bundesliga this term, netting five goals and claiming six assists, while across his eight-year Bayern career, he has been central to seven Bundesliga crowns and a Champions League.

However, the 28-year-old was allegedly angered by Julian Nagelsmann’s sacking back in March and is said to be seeking a new challenge.

Kimmich still has two years left on his current deal but has not yet given any indication that he is willing to sign an extension.

Advert

Beyond Liverpool and Arsenal, Premier League champions City, who are on course for a historic treble, are also said to be keeping tabs on Kimmich.
